HomeMy WebLinkAboutResolutions - No. 2023-193RESOLUTION NO. 2023-193 A RESOLUTION OF THE LODI CITY COUNCIL A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ER TO EXECUTE A PROFESSIONAL SERVICES AGREEMENT WITH CROSSROADS SOFTWARE, INC., OF BREA, FOR A CITATION WRITING SYSTEM, RMS INTERFACE, AND CALIFORNIA HIGHWAY PATROL STATEWIDE INTEGRATED TRAFFIC RECORDS SYSTEM UPLOAD SYSTEM AND THE CORRESPONDING PURCHASE OF HANDHELD CITATION PRINTERS FROM BARCODES, INC., OF CHICAGO, ILLINOIS WHEREAS, California Highway Patrol (CHP) 180 forms are used when officers tow a ✓ehicle, track and report a stolen vehicle, and for abandoned vehicle abatement. The Lodi Police Department (LPD) completes around 900 forms a year; and WHEREAS, the increase in field citations and the volume of CHP 180 forms have placed .ime-consuming administrative tasks on officers and have significantly increased the workload for .he Police Records unit; and WHEREAS, the Crossroads citation writing system allows officers to scan drivers' licenses and vehicle registration to automatically upload and import the offenders' data into a cellular phone -based application where the data is formatted in the application to complete the citation; and WHEREAS, in order to utilize the e -citation software and electronic forms, LPD will need to purchase handheld citation printers directly linking to the application platform and give citizens hard copies of the citations at the time of the traffic stop; and WHEREAS, the authorization of this contract will streamline the City's officers' and Record Clerks' citation and tow forms process to ensure the Department is boosting productivity while minimizing redundancy and errors in data entry.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the Lodi City Council does hereby authorize the City Manager to execute a five-year Professional Services Agreement with Crossroads Software, Inc., of Brea, California, and approve the corresponding purchase from Barcodes, Inc., of Chicago, Illinois, in an amount not to exceed $110,000; and B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, pursuant to Section 6.3q of the City Council Protocol Manual (adopted 11/6/19, Resolution No. 2019-223), the City Attorney is hereby authorized to make minor revisions to the above -referenced document(s) that do not alter the compensation or term, and to make clerical corrections as necessary.
